A particle is projected in a gravity free space. If the particle suffers deviation but its kinetic energy remains unchanged, then in that region

a

‘E’ may be zero but ‘B’ must not be zero

b

‘E’ must be zero but ‘B’ must not be zero

c

‘E’ and ‘B’ both must not be zero

d

‘E’ must not be zero but ‘B’ may be zero

answer is B.

Detailed Solution

Due to the action of electric force, the kinetic energy of the particle must change but since direction of magnetic force FB→=QV→×B→ is always perpendicular to the direction of motion and hence wok done by magnetic force on the particle is zero and its kinetic energy remains unchanged.Hence option -(2) is correct
